Output 40ddf74c91dcaeeca25f85e8db1411b2406256af3b3aa370a2005f883603e4b0:3

value
13254747380
script pubkey
OP_0 OP_PUSHBYTES_20 9d3371e0ad4da597e94038219786fb175a263a6e
address
ltc1qn5ehrc9dfkje062q8qse0phmzadzvwnw8y587s
transaction
40ddf74c91dcaeeca25f85e8db1411b2406256af3b3aa370a2005f883603e4b0
spent
true